/*
* --------------------------------------------------------------------------------------------------------------------
* Example to fix a broken UID changeable MIFARE cards.
* --------------------------------------------------------------------------------------------------------------------
* This is a MFRC522 library example; for further details and other examples see: https://github.com/OSSLibraries/Arduino_MFRC522v2
*
* This sample shows how to fix a broken UID changeable MIFARE cards that have a corrupted sector 0.
*
* @author Tom Clement
* @license Released into the public domain.
*
* Typical pin layout used:
* -----------------------------------------------------------------------------------------
* MFRC522 Arduino Arduino Arduino Arduino Arduino
* Reader/PCD Uno/101 Mega Nano v3 Leonardo/Micro Pro Micro
* Signal Pin Pin Pin Pin Pin Pin
* -----------------------------------------------------------------------------------------
* SPI SS SDA(SS) 10 53 D10 10 10
* SPI MOSI MOSI 11 / ICSP-4 51 D11 ICSP-4 16
* SPI MISO MISO 12 / ICSP-1 50 D12 ICSP-1 14
* SPI SCK SCK 13 / ICSP-3 52 D13 ICSP-3 15
*
* Not found? For more see: https://github.com/OSSLibraries/Arduino_MFRC522v2#pin-layout
*/
#include <MFRC522v2.h>
#include <MFRC522DriverSPI.h>
//#include <MFRC522DriverI2C.h>
#include <MFRC522DriverPinSimple.h>
#include <MFRC522Hack.h>
MFRC522DriverPinSimple ss_pin(10); // Configurable, see typical pin layout above.
MFRC522DriverSPI driver(ss_pin);
//MFRC522DriverI2C driver();
MFRC522 mfrc522(driver); // Create MFRC522 instance.
MFRC522Hack mfrc522Hack(mfrc522, true); // Create MFRC522Hack instance.
MFRC522::MIFARE_Key key;
void setup() {
Serial.begin(115200); // Initialize serial communications with the PC for debugging.
while (!Serial); // Do nothing if no serial port is opened (added for Arduinos based on ATMEGA32U4).
mfrc522.PCD_Init(); // Init MFRC522 board.
Serial.println(F("Warning: this example overwrites the UID of your UID changeable card, use with care!"));
Serial.println(F("This example only works with MIFARE Classic cards."));
// Prepare key - all keys are set to FFFFFFFFFFFFh at chip delivery from the factory.
for (byte i = 0; i < 6; i++) {
key.keyByte[i] = 0xFF;
}
}
void loop() {
if ( mfrc522Hack.MIFARE_UnbrickUidSector() ) {
Serial.println(F("Cleared sector 0, set UID to 1234. Card should be responsive again now."));
}
delay(1000);
}
